    Water Leakage Analysis of Underwater Vehicle Engine

    • The cam engine is a significant component of thermal power unit in underwater vehicles, and its performance is usually verified by power test. In a power test preparation for an underwater vehicle, some water leaked out between the bulkhead and driving gear of the cam engine. In order to determine the failure cause, three fault factors, including gaskets, personnel practice and set screws, were put into consideration and validation tests. Test results show that the fault is caused by excessive perpendicularity of set screws, which exceeds GB standards and caused seal failure. Then, increasing the perpendicularity of screws and improving inspection process of set screws are proposed. The research has actual effects on reliability design of set screws, and provides a necessary basis for perfecting relevant technologies of factory, army and so on.
